As the Talent Acquisition Business Partner – Commercial you will report to the Sr. Mgr, Global Talent Acquisition.

In this role, you will collaborate closely with hiring managers and HR Business Partners to attract and secure top talent for the organization. You will be responsible for sourcing, assessing, and matching candidates to roles across the company, ensuring alignment with business needs and culture.

Your day-to-day will include proactively identifying high-potential candidates through various sourcing channels, conducting thorough interviews (phone, video, and in-person), and guiding candidates through the recruitment journey. You will also engage in regular strategy discussions with hiring managers to align on talent needs and ensure recruitment efforts support broader business objectives.



Responsibilities

•    Lead the end-to-end recruitment process, including requisition creation, candidate sourcing and screening, interview coordination, debrief sessions, offer negotiation, and requisition closure.
•    Build strong partnerships with hiring managers to understand their talent needs and develop tailored recruitment strategies, while providing regular updates on requisition status.
•    Act as the primary advisor on all Talent Acquisition matters, offering guidance and support to both candidates and hiring managers throughout the hiring process.
•    Design and implement innovative, multi-channel sourcing strategies, including direct sourcing, social media, professional networks, employee referrals, targeted advertising, and university outreach.
•    Manage internal and external job postings and oversee third-party recruiter relationships, including reviewing candidate submissions, coordinating interviews, and ensuring active recruiting agreements are in place with favorable terms.
•    Ensure compliance with EEO requirements by managing self-identification requests, maintaining applicant records, and including appropriate legal disclaimers in job postings.
•    Accurately track and manage applicant flow using the applicant tracking system (ATS), ensuring data integrity and consistency.
•    Prepare and deliver weekly requisition status reports for assigned business areas.
•    Support additional projects and perform other duties as assigned by management.
